如何将织梦(dedecms)中的RSS和sitemap路径优化至根目录?

要将织梦(dedecms)的RSS和sitemap路径更改至根目录,你需要编辑后台的系统设置,找到对应的路径选项并修改为根目录下的路径。确保修改后保存设置,并更新系统的缓存。这样可以帮助搜索引擎更好地抓取网站内容。

在当今互联网时代,搜索引擎优化(SEO)已成为网站运营中不可或缺的一部分,织梦(DedeCMS)作为一种流行的内容管理系统,因其灵活、方便的特性而广受站长们的青睐,系统的默认设置并不总是与SEO最佳实践完全吻合,RSS和sitemap的默认存放路径通常位于站点的子目录,而非根目录,本文将详细阐述如何更改DedeCMS中的RSS及sitemap路径至根目录,以提升网站的SEO表现。

织梦(dedecms)优化之更改RSS、sitemap路径至根目录
(图片来源网络,侵删)

理解为何需要更改RSS和sitemap的路径至关重要,默认情况下,DedeCMS将这些文件存放在子目录(如data目录),这可能对搜索引擎爬虫的访问造成不便,通过将它们移至根目录,可以增加这些文件被爬虫发现和访问的概率,进而加快内容的索引速度,提升网站在搜索结果中的排名。

进入操作步骤:

1、备份网站数据和数据库

在执行任何文件修改前,备份是一个必不可少的步骤,这确保了如果操作失误,可以迅速恢复到修改前的状态,避免对网站运行造成影响。

2、定位到管理文件夹

根据DedeCMS的版本,管理文件夹的名称可能有所不同,对于V5.7、V5.6及V5.5等版本,管理文件夹通常命名为dede,在此文件夹中,找到makehtml_map.php文件。

3、编辑makehtml_map.php文件

织梦(dedecms)优化之更改RSS、sitemap路径至根目录
(图片来源网络,侵删)

使用文本编辑器打开makehtml_map.php文件,搜索“rss”关键词,在文件中,特别注意第17行和第22行,这两行代码定义了RSS的生成路径,默认情况下,路径中包含“/data”,需要将其删除,以确保RSS文件可以直接生成于网站根目录下。

4、修改sitemap路径

同样在makehtml_map.php文件中,确认并修改sitemap路径,确保所有涉及到生成路径的代码行都已修改,使sitemap文件也能直接生成于根目录下,这对于搜索引擎快速抓取网站内容极为重要。

5、测试更改

更改完成后,通过DedeCMS后台生成新的RSS和sitemap文件,检查它们是否已正确生成在根目录下,注意观察网站运行是否正常,确保修改没有引入新的问题。

6、监控网站表现

在随后的日子里,通过各种SEO工具监控网站的索引情况和搜索排名,查看改动是否带来了积极的影响,如索引速度的提升和搜索排名的上升。

织梦(dedecms)优化之更改RSS、sitemap路径至根目录
(图片来源网络,侵删)

在操作过程中,可能会遇到以下错误信息:“DedeTag Engine Create File False”,这通常意味着由于权限问题,系统无法在指定目录创建文件,应检查根目录是否有写入权限,或手动在根目录下创建RSS文件夹,并设置合适的权限。

归纳而言,更改DedeCMS中RSS和sitemap的路径至根目录,是优化网站结构、提升搜索引擎友好度的重要步骤,通过上述详细的操作指南,即使是非技术背景的网站管理员也能轻松完成这一优化任务。

针对操作过程和后续效果监测,以下是一些常见问题解答:

FAQs

Q1: 修改后,如何验证RSS和sitemap路径已成功更改?

A1: 可以通过访问 http://您的网站域名/sitemap.html 和 http://您的网站域名/rssmap.html 来验证,如果能够正常显示内容,表明路径更改成功。

Q2: 如果操作后发现网站出现错误,我该如何恢复?

A2: 使用之前备份的数据和数据库进行恢复,确保在重新操作前仔细检查每一步骤,避免再次出错。

通过以上步骤和注意事项,可以有效地将DedeCMS中的RSS和sitemap路径更改至网站根目录,为网站SEO优化奠定坚实基础。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/978486.html

本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
未希新媒体运营
上一篇 2024-09-02 20:10
下一篇 2024-09-02 20:10

相关推荐

  • 如何在织梦(DedeCMS)中自定义留言板功能并实现调用head.htm文件?

    在织梦(dedecms)中自定义留言板功能并调用head.htm文件,首先需要在模板文件夹中创建一个新的留言板模板文件,然后在该文件中使用{dede:include file=”head.htm” /}标签来引入head.htm文件。

    2024-10-25
    023
  • 如何实现织梦(dedecms)模板中自定义字段的排序功能?

    在织梦(dedecms)模板中实现自定义字段排序功能,可以通过修改模板文件和添加相应的SQL查询语句来实现。具体步骤如下:,,1. 在模板文件中添加一个表单,用于接收用户输入的排序字段和排序方式。,,“html,,排序字段:,,字段1,字段2,,,排序方式:,,升序,降序,,,,`,,2. 在your_action_file.php中,接收表单传递过来的排序字段和排序方式参数,并根据这些参数构造SQL查询语句。,,`php,,“,,3. 根据构造好的SQL查询语句,执行查询并输出结果。这部分代码需要根据你的实际需求和数据库结构进行编写。

    2024-10-23
    017
  • 如何在DedeCMS织梦后台实现Sitemap百度Ping推送功能?

    要实现dedecms织梦后台Sitemap百度Ping推送功能,可以按照以下步骤操作:,,1. 确保你的网站已经安装了百度站长工具,并验证了网站的所有权。,2. 在dedecms织梦后台找到“生成”菜单,点击“更新主页HTML”。,3. 在“更新主页HTML”页面中,找到“生成Sitemap”选项,勾选它,然后点击“生成”按钮。这将生成一个名为sitemap.xml的文件,该文件包含了你网站上所有页面的URL。,4. 打开百度站长工具,找到“链接提交”菜单,点击“自动推送”。,5. 在“自动推送”页面中,点击“添加推送规则”,然后输入刚刚生成的sitemap.xml文件的URL,最后点击“保存”按钮。,6. 每当你的网站有新的内容更新时,百度会自动抓取sitemap.xml文件中的URL,并将其添加到搜索索引中。,,通过以上步骤,你就可以实现dedecms织梦后台Sitemap百度Ping推送功能了。

    2024-10-13
    07
  • 如何在织梦(dedecms)中实现下拉搜索指定栏目的功能?

    要实现织梦(dedecms)下拉搜索指定栏目功能,可以通过以下步骤进行操作:,,1. 打开织梦后台,找到“模板管理”选项。,2. 在模板管理中找到需要添加下拉搜索的模板文件,例如首页模板。,3. 编辑模板文件,将以下代码添加到需要显示下拉搜索的位置:,,“html,,,请选择栏目, {dede:sql sqltext=’SELECT id,typename FROM dede_arctype WHERE reid=0 AND channeltype=0′},{$typename}, {/dede:sql},,,,,“,,4. 保存模板文件并更新缓存。,,这样,当用户在下拉菜单中选择一个栏目时,表单会自动提交,跳转到指定栏目的搜索结果页面。

    2024-10-09
    05

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

产品购买 QQ咨询 微信咨询 SEO优化
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购 >>点击进入